1. A plated steel sheet, comprising:
a base steel sheet;
a Zn—Mg—Al based steel sheet plating layer provided on at least one surface of the base steel sheet; and
an Fe—Al based inhibition layer provided between the base steel sheet and the Zn—Mg—Al based plating layer,
wherein the plating layer comprises, by weight:
4% or more of Mg; 2.1 times or more of a Mg content and 14.2% or less of Al; 0.2% or less (including 0%) of Si; 0.1% or less (including 0%) of Sn, with a balance of Zn and unavoidable impurities,
wherein, in a cut surface of the steel sheet in a thickness direction, when an interface line of the base steel sheet is spaced 5 μm apart toward a surface of the plating layer, a length occupied by an outburst phase intersecting the spaced line is 10% or less compared to a length of the spaced line, and,
a Fe content of the outburst phase is 10 to 45% by weight, and an alloy phase of the outburst phase contains at least one of Fe2Al5, FeAl and Fe—Zn compounds, and contains 20% or more of Zn by weight, and
wherein the outburst phase is an alloy phase including a Fe—Al based intermetallic compound other than the inhibition layer.
